Output 572861b881fc48be90b89a1702233d78383fa553441ae254f6bdb3a74478490d:2

value
140314
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 649c2d43bfe8127614ec6262755d600326c69e05 OP_EQUALVERIFY OP_CHECKSIG
address
1AAyfYE8nWvvWT4zxXYpgqJFiHNL9B9rdj
transaction
572861b881fc48be90b89a1702233d78383fa553441ae254f6bdb3a74478490d
spent
true